Drawn by faith for centuries lets pause before the Chota Hanuman Mandir. This ancient temple in Delhi is not just a place of worship. It is a testament to history and devotion.

The Chota Hanuman Mandir is claimed to be one of the five temples from the Mahabharata era in Delhi. Legend says the Pandavas built it after their victory in the Kurukshetra war. This makes it a site of immense historical significance.

The temple’s origins are linked to Maharaja Man Singh I of Amber. He is said to have built it during Emperor Akbar’s reign. Maharaja Jai Singh rebuilt it in 1724 around the same time as the Jantar Mantar. Over the years, improvements have made it a central religious spot.

Look up at the spire. Notice the unusual crescent moon instead of the typical Hindu Aum or Sun symbol. Legend says that when Tulsidas visited Delhi he was summoned by the Mughal Emperor. Asked to perform a miracle Tulsidas did so with Lord Hanuman’s blessings. The Emperor then gifted the temple the crescent moon finial. It is also believed this symbol protected the temple from destruction by Muslim rulers.

The idol here is known as Sri Hanuman Ji Maharaj. It depicts Bala Hanuman that is Hanuman as a child. The idol faces south. Devotees can see only one eye. The idol holds a Gada or mace in its left hand. Its right hand crosses the chest showing respect to Rama Lakshmana and Sita.

Enter through the silver-plated doors. They show scenes from the Ramayana. Inside paintings of Hanuman adorn the walls in all directions. Below each painting verses from Tulsidas’s Sundar Kand are inscribed on marble tablets. The temple is 108 feet tall. Its main hall shows scenes from the Ramayana.

An important tradition here is the continuous chanting of the mantra Sri Ram Jai Ram Jai Jai Ram. This has been going on since August 1 1964. It is even recorded in the Guinness Book of World Records.

Tuesday and Saturday are special days. Devotees gather here in large numbers to worship. Hanuman Jayanti is celebrated with grand processions. People wear Hanuman masks and carry idols of Hanuman.
